1. Do I need to do tele verification of address before the sim will be activated because when I asked them which number to call for tele verification they said you don’t need to it on evdo sim.
2. They gave me two bills of Rs. 40 & 350 respectively. So when my number is activated I just have to recharge it with Rs. 21 for 6 months validity & Rs. 55 for 2 days unlimited data. Or I have to recharge it with some Frc
3. As I am totally new to CDMA Evdo thing I have no device to check whether my number is activated or not ( As I have ordered a used mts dongle so not sure if I just insert evdo sim and I will get the network on the dashboard without any hassle ) so is there a way to know weither the sim is activated or not like calling the evdo sim from other number ( like now it’s saying please check the number and dial again but after activation it should say the dialed number is switched off).
1- No tele verification is required.
2- Bill of 40 Rs. is for Sim card and 350 Rs. for activation charge. Sim’s validity will be initially for 1 month after that you have to recharge with validity pack. After activation of the sim you have to recharge with data pack.
3- When you got network then you can check the activation status by calling(incoming/outgoing).
Note:- Personally i will recommend you to buy Modem from BSNL it will costs you Rs1200 and you haven’t pay 350 Rs (Sim activation charge). I am using Prithvi Modem from last 2.5 Years and haven’t faced any issue.
